OVERVIEW OF THE COMPANY
Fox Television Stations owns and operates 29 full‑power broadcast television stations in the U.S., including 14 of the top 15 largest designated market areas (DMAs) and duopolies in 11 DMAs such as New York, Los Angeles, and Chicago. 18 stations are affiliated with the FOX Network. The stations produce roughly 1,200 hours of local news each week and distribute sports, entertainment, and syndicated content.
